Bookseller’s Catalogues delves into the rich history and significance of booksellers’ catalogues. This work explores the evolution of these catalogues as vital tools for the book trade, offering insights into the rare and antiquarian book market. Authored by David Nutt, the book provides a comprehensive overview of how booksellers’ catalogues have shaped the distribution and appreciation of literary works over time. It serves as an essential resource for collectors, historians, and anyone interested in the world of bookselling.This work has been selected by scholars as being culturally important, and is part of the knowledge base of civilization as we know it.
